
What is recorded here
Detached three-bay single-storey vernacular house, built c. 1880, with windbreak porch and outbuildings to both gables. Thatched pitched roof with smooth rendered gable ended chimneystacks. Square-headed window openings with two-over-two horned timber sash windows. Square-headed door opening with battened timber door. Outbuilding with corrugated-metal roof to gable. Large outbuilding with corrugated tin roof, rubble stone walls and square-headed door openings to south. Modern farm buildings to site.
